See \emph{\LaTeX{} News~31}~\cite{12:site-news} for more details on this. \section{New features in \pkg{expl3}} \subsection{A new argument specifier: \texttt{e}-type} During 2018, the team worked with the \TeX{} Live, \hologo{XeTeX} and (u)p\TeX{} developers to add the \cs{expanded} primitive to \hologo{pdfTeX}{}, \hologo{XeTeX} and (u)p\TeX{}. This primitive was originally suggested for \hologo{pdfTeX}{} v1.50 (never released), and was present in \hologo{LuaTeX}{} from the start of that project. Adding \cs{expanded} lets us create a new argument specifier: \texttt{e}-type expansion. This is \emph{almost} the same as \texttt{x}-type, but is itself expandable. (It also doesn't need doubled \verb|#| tokens.) That's incredibly useful for creating function-like macros: you can ensure that \emph{everything} is expanded in an argument before you go near it, with not an \cs{expandafter} in sight. \subsection{New functions} New programming tools have appeared in various places across \pkg{expl3}. Spaces and quotes in file names are now fully normalised, in a similar manner to the approach used by the latest \LaTeXe{} kernel. \subsection{String conversion moves to \pkg{expl3}} In addition to entirely new functions, the team have moved the \pkg{l3str-convert} module from the \pkg{l3experimental} bundle into the \pkg{expl3} core. This module is essential for dealing with the need to produce UTF-16 and UTF-32 strings in some contexts, and also offers built-in escape for url and PDF strings. \subsection{Case changing of text} Within \pkg{expl3}, the team have renamed and reworked the ideas from \cs{tl_upper_case:n} and so on, creating a new module \pkg{l3text}. This is a \enquote{final} home for functions to manipulate \emph{text}; token lists that can reasonably be expected to expand to plain text plus limited markup, for example emphasis and labels/references. Moving these functions, we have also made a small number of changes in other modules to give consistent names to functions: see the change log for full details. Over time, we anticipate that functions for other textual manipulation will be added to this module. \section{Notable fixes and changes} \subsection{File name parsing} The functions for parsing file names have been entirely rewritten, partly as this is required for the expandable access to file information mentioned above. The new code correctly deals with spaces and quote marks in file names and splits the path/name/extension. \subsection{Message formatting} The format of messages in \pkg{expl3} was originally quite text-heavy, the idea being that they would stand out in the \texttt{.log} file. However, this made them hard to find by a regular expression search, and was very different from the \LaTeXe{} message approach. The formatting of \pkg{expl3} messages has been aligned with that from the \LaTeXe{} kernel, such that IDE scripts and similar will be able to find and extract them directly. \subsection{Key inheritance} A number of changes have been made to the inheritance code for keys, to allow inheritance to work \enquote{as expected} in (almost) all cases. \subsection{Floating point juxtaposition} Implicit multiplication by juxtaposition, such as \verb|2pi|, is now handled separately from parenthetic values. Thus for example \verb|1in/1cm| is treated as equal to \verb|(1in)/(1cm)| and thus yields \verb|2.54|, and \verb|1/2(pi+pi)| is equal to \verb|pi|. \subsection{Changing box dimensions} \TeX{}'s handling of boxes is subtly different from other registers, and this shows up in particular when you want to resize a box. To bring treatment of boxes, or rather the grouping behavior of boxes, into line with other registers, we have made some internal changes to how functions such as \cs{box_set_wd:N} are implemented. The team hopes to move all functions in \pkg{expl3} to stable status, or move them out of the core, over the coming months. \subsection{Deprecations} There have been two notable sets of deprecations over the past 18 months. First, we have rationalised all of the \enquote{raw} primitive names to the form \cs{tex_:D}. This means that the older names, starting \mbox{\cs{pdftex_...}}, \cs{xetex_...}, etc., have been removed. Secondly, the use of integer constants, which dates back to the earliest days of \pkg{expl3}, is today more likely to make the code harder to read than anything else. Speed improvements in engines mean that the tiny enhancements in reading such constants are no longer required. Thus for example \cs{c_two} is deprecated in favour of simply using \texttt{2}. In parallel with this, a number of older \texttt{.sty} files have been removed. These older files provided legacy stubs for files which have now been integrated in the \pkg{expl3} core. These are simple Markdown text files, which means that they can be displayed formatted in web views. \section{Changes in \pkg{xparse}} A number of new features have been added to \pkg{xparse}. To allow handling of the fact that skipping spaces may be required only in some cases when searching for optional arguments, a new modifier \texttt{!} is available in argument specifiers. This causes \pkg{xparse} to \emph{require} that an optional argument follows immediately with no intervening spaces. There is a new argument type purely for environments: \texttt{b}-type for collecting a \cs{begin}\texttt{...}\cs{end} pair, i.e., collecting the body of an environment. This is similar in concept to the \pkg{environ} package, but is integrated directly into \pkg{xparse}. Finally, it is now possible to refer to one argument as the default for another optional one, for example \begin{verbatim} \NewDocumentCommand{\caption}{O{#2} m} ... \end{verbatim} \section{New experimental modules} A number of new experimental modules have been added within the \pkg{l3experimental} bundle: \begin{description} \item[\pkg{l3benchmark}] Performance-testing system using the timing function in modern \TeX{} engines \item[\pkg{l3cctab}] Category code tables for all engines, not just \hologo{LuaTeX} \item[\pkg{l3color}] Color support, similar in interface to \pkg{xcolor} \item[\pkg{l3draw}] Creation of drawings, inspired by \pkg{pgf}, but using the \LaTeX3 FPU for calculations \item[\pkg{l3pdf}] Support for PDF features such as compression, hyperlinks, etc. \item[\pkg{l3sys-shell}] Shell escape functions for file manipulation \end{description} \section{\pkg{l3build} changes} The \pkg{l3build} tool for testing and releasing \TeX{} packages has seen a number of incremental improvements. It is now available directly as a script in \TeX{} Live and MiK\TeX{}, meaning you can call it simply as \begin{verbatim} l3build \end{verbatim} Accompanying this, we have added support for installing scripts and script \texttt{man} files. There is a new \texttt{upload} target that can take a zip file and send it to CTAN: you just have to fill in release information for \emph{this} upload at the prompts. Testing using PDF files rather than logs has been heavily revised: this is vital for work on PDF tagging. There is also better support for complex directory structures, including the ability to manually specify TDS location for all installed files. This is particularly targeted at packages with both generic and format-specific files to install. \begin{thebibliography}{9} \fontsize{9.9}{11.9}\selectfont \bibitem{12:site} \emph{\LaTeX{} Project Website}. \hfil\break\url{https://latex-project.org/} \bibitem{12:site-news} \emph{\LaTeXe{} release newsletters on the \LaTeX{} Project Website}. \url{https://latex-project.org/news/latex2e-news/} \end{thebibliography} \end{document}
